Cat Oli was one of many crew members on the final crusing boat to complete the Sydney to Hobart yacht race in Australia on Wednesday.
The dock was stuffed with supporters cheering on the oldest boat within the race, the Sylph VI, because it got here into Structure Dock, with Oli carried up on deck to greet his adoring followers. Some folks held indicators, and others introduced presents for the cat sailor.
“I believe it’s fairly superb how folks have, you already know, taken a shine to Oli. It was not one thing I anticipated, you already know, for me Oli is simply a part of my crew, a part of my, you already know, the boat, and I’ve sailed with him for a number of years,” proprietor Bob Williams, who acquired a bit emotional from all the eye, mentioned.
For the previous 5 years, Bob sailed with cat Oli across the nation, describing Oli as “my buddy and mate.” They even crossed the Tasman Sea collectively to New Zealand.
“Yeah, he’s change into fairly a global movie star apparently, which is sort of superb. He’s simply an abnormal little moggy, my buddy and mate, and it’s fairly a pleasant factor to have this little little bit of consideration in spite of everything this time,” Bob mentioned.
The duo and two different sailors departed Sydney for Hobart on December 26.
